From: Glutathione supplementation improves fat graft survival by inhibiting ferroptosis via the SLC7A11/GPX4 axis

Fig. 7

GSH rescues ADSCs from ferroptosis by activating the SLC7A11/GPX4 axis. a Cell viability in the OGD model at different concentrations of GSH (n = 3). b Attenuation of decreased cell viability in the OGD- and erastin-treated groups by GSH (n = 3). c Intracellular reactive oxygen species (ROS) levels determined by flow cytometry (n = 3). d BODIPY staining for lipid peroxidation in ADSCs (n = 3). e, f Intracellular MDA and SOD levels in each treatment group (n = 3). g, h Protein expression and quantification of GPX4, SLC7A11 by western blotting (n = 3). Full-length blots are presented in Additional file 4. Data are presented as the mean ± SD. *p < 0.05, **p < 0.01
